Disproving the Misconception of Cleaning Harder for Cleaner Teeth



Don't think the misconception that cleaning harder will certainly cause cleaner teeth. Many individuals believe that applying more stress while brushing will certainly eliminate extra plaque and bacteria from their teeth. However, this isn't real, and in fact, it can be harmful to your oral wellness.

The secret to efficient brushing isn't compel, yet method and uniformity.

It's recommended to make use of a soft-bristled toothbrush and gentle, round motions to clean up all surface areas of your teeth. Furthermore, brushing for at the very least 2 mins two times a day, in addition to regular flossing and dental check-ups, is necessary for maintaining a healthy smile.

Common Dental Myths: What You Need to Know



Don't be fooled by the misconception that sugar is the major culprit behind tooth decay and dental caries.

While it's true that sugar can add to dental troubles, it isn't the single reason.



Dental cavity takes place when dangerous bacteria in your mouth prey on the sugars and starches from the foods you take in.

These bacteria produce acids that wear down the enamel, bring about cavities.

However, poor dental hygiene, such as poor brushing and flossing, plays a significant function in the development of dental caries as well.

Furthermore, certain factors like genes, completely dry mouth, and acidic foods can likewise add to oral concerns.
